Gas Production Lab

We have already seen a few of the signs or evidence of a chemical change. The MOM lab showed us permanent color change and the precipitate lab showed us two liquids can form a solid.

Page 2: Gas Production Lab We have already seen a few of the signs or evidence of a chemical change. The MOM lab showed us permanent color change and the precipitate.

Remember the signs of gas production?

•Bubbling•Foaming•Fizzing•Or sometimes a smell is produced.

The Wooden Splint

The wooden splint will be used during the lab in a special way, so there are some instructions you need for it’s use. You will light it and let it burn for a few seconds, then blow it out, so you have an ember, what you have on the end of a punk. It needs to be glowing. DO NOT LIGHT IT YET! You will use it to test the gas produced.

Step 2

•Make a before drawing of the materials.•Pour the hydrogen peroxide into the yeast.•Observe and record what happens. Feel the bottom of the cup!•Make an after drawing of the materials.

What happened?

•The yeast acts a catalyst and causes the hydrogen peroxide (H2O2) to turn into water (H2O).

Something to think about.

Earlier this year we exploded a hydrogen balloon. We were able to do this because hydrogen is flammable.The gas we created today did not explode. It helped the splint to burn, because wood is flammable.
